STMA 10AAA Baseball Wins Gopher State Tournament of Champions
Front Row: Quinton Berres, Austin Nickel, Cody Reckard, Tyler Hoselton, Hunter Wilcox / Middle Row: Carter Smith, Brandon Berning, Riley Breen, Jake Bloomstrand, Tucker Bjorlin, Marshall Bjorlin, Drew Hinkemeyer / Coaches: Steve Hinkemeyer, Brent Bjorlin, Dan Reckard, Harry Hoselton
The STMA 10 AAA boys baseball team capped off an incredible 37-5 season by winning the prestigious Gopher State Tournament of Champions held in Bloomington, MN. STMA was seeded 2nd out of the 28 teams to participate in this invitational tournament by winning the Woodbury and Elk River tournaments earlier in the season.
The Knights began the tournament by winning their pool games over Orono 15-0, Andover 11-1, and Eden Prairie 4-3 to move on to the championship bracket. In the eight team championship bracket, STMA bats stayed hot to defeat Lakeville 13-9 in the first round game. In the semi-final game against Sioux Falls, the Knights needed a last inning rally to tie the game 2-2 and send it into extra innings. In the 7th inning, the Knights scored the game winning run and held Sioux Falls scoreless to advance to the championship game with a 3-2 victory.
The championship game pitted #2 seeded STMA vs. #1 seeded Brooklyn Park. STMA jumped out to an early lead and never looked back. Strong pitching and flawless defense helped the Knights seal the 9-0 victory and take home the title. As a reward for winning, each player will receive a custom engraved championship ring from Jostens presented on the field at the Metrodome before the September 6th Twins game against the Detroit Tigers.
